The flaw exists in the GET /tools/site-checker endpoint, located in apps/api/src/controllers/tools.controller.ts, which fails to validate user-supplied URL inputs. An unauthenticated attacker can exploit this endpoint by providing a malicious URL parameter to the fetchWithRedirects function.\u003c/p\u003e\n\u003cp\u003eThis vulnerability allows attackers to perform unauthorized HTTP requests from the server context, enabling them to probe internal services, scan local network ports, and access cloud instance metadata services (such as AWS/GCP/Azure metadata endpoints). Furthermore, the application returns response details, including status codes, page sizes, and HTML metadata, which can be leveraged for network reconnaissance. The vulnerability also supports leaking internal IP address information to third-party endpoints via the getIPInfo function. Defenders should prioritize patching all Openpanel instances to version 2.3.0 or later to remediate this vector.\u003c/p\u003e\n\u003ch2 id=\"impact\"\u003eImpact\u003c/h2\u003e\n\u003cp\u003eSuccessful exploitation allows unauthenticated remote attackers to gain unauthorized visibility into internal network infrastructure, potentially leading to information disclosure of sensitive internal configurations, cloud environment secrets, or local service status. This exposure could serve as a precursor to further exploitation of internal services that were not intended to be internet-facing.\u003c/p\u003e\n\u003ch2 id=\"recommendation\"\u003eRecommendation\u003c/h2\u003e\n\u003cp\u003ePrioritize the following actions to secure vulnerable Openpanel installations:\u003c/p\u003e\n\u003cul\u003e\n\u003cli\u003eImmediately upgrade all Openpanel instances to version 2.3.0 or later to address CVE-2026-85609.\u003c/li\u003e\n\u003cli\u003eImplement egress filtering on the server hosting Openpanel to restrict network requests to authorized external domains only, preventing access to internal network segments or cloud metadata services.\u003c/li\u003e\n\u003cli\u003eAudit web server access logs for repeated requests to /tools/site-checker containing suspicious query parameters, such as internal IP addresses (169.254.169.254, 10.x.x.x, 172.16-31.x.x, 192.168.x.x) or common internal service ports.\u003c/li\u003e\n\u003c/ul\u003e\n","date_modified":"2026-09-04T13:26:29Z","date_published":"2026-09-04T13:26:07Z","id":"https://feed.craftedsignal.io/briefs/2026-09-openpanel-ssrf/","summary":"Openpanel versions before 2.3.0 are vulnerable to an unauthenticated server-side request forgery (SSRF) flaw in the /tools/site-checker endpoint that allows internal network probing and cloud metadata access.","title":"Unauthenticated SSRF in Openpanel Site Checker","url":"https://feed.craftedsignal.io/briefs/2026-09-openpanel-ssrf/"}],"language":"en","title":"CraftedSignal Threat Feed - Openpanel","version":"https://jsonfeed.org/version/1.1"}
